This second edition of Horse Anatomy: A Pictorial Approach to Equine Structure has been completely revised and enlarged. Its original 25 pages of illustrations have more than doubled and now include over 250 individual drawings. All of these drawings have been specially prepared for this new edition by John Goody, and all are fully labelled and annotated in the accompanying legends. The text is primarily intended to explain and in many instances to expand upon the content of the drawings. The basic make-up of the horse is considered with the 'points' of the horse being shown from several different views. Bones, muscles, tendons, and ligaments providing the anatomical basis for these surface points are dealt with in some detail, the emphasis being placed throughout on those structures that can be seen or felt from the surface of the body. Component parts of the digestive, respiratory, urinary and reproductive systems are shown in a number of the drawings, as are nerves and blood vessels. Special consideration is given to the structure of the head, with the emphasis on the nasal cavity, teeth, larynx and guttural pouches. The structure of the limbs is also illustrated in considerable detail, especially the foot, and reference is made to injuries and diseases that can result in poor conformation. Excerpt from The Points of the Horse: A Familiar Treatise on Equine Conformation In the attempt to conform to the requirements of truth, I have, as far as practicable, relied on photography for illustration. This art not alone gives exact representations with marvellous minuteness of detail, but has completed the solution (begun by Professor Marey) of the once vexed question of the action of the horse's limbs during the various forms of movement, and has accordingly afforded us, in our present study, data which are as instructive as they are reliable. As I have written this book for non-scientific readers, as well as for those who desire to thoroughly master the subject; I have placed in small print the few chapters which I have devoted to the anatomical and mechanical details which were necessary to render the work complete. A perusal of the large print chapters will give a good general view of the practical side of the subject, and, in most cases, the reasons for the opinions advanced. The information contained in the small print ones is, however, indispensable for the full comprehension of all the principles discussed, and as it is of a very elementary character, I trust it will not be neglected. We must here remember that the horse is a living machine, the capabilities of which cannot be accurately gauged, without a knowledge of its construction, and of the principles of its working. Having treated on Sowea'ness and Age of Horses in another book, I have omitted these subjects entirely from the present one. I must, however, state that as they are directly connected with the question of a horse standing work, it is impossible to judge his capabilities with a near approach to correctness, Without a knowledge of veterinary science. Besides the new features in this book to which I have already drawn notice, I may mention that I have tried to arrive at a knowledge of the respective points of speed and strength in the horse, by examining the conformation of other animals that are distinguished by the possession of one or other of these gifts in a high state of perfection. Also, I have made a more exhaustive inquiry into the nature of the paces and of the leap of the horse than has previously been attempted; my object being to obtain from it exact deduc tions as to the best kind of conformation for various forms of work.
